Business Impact

Negative Unit Economics. The cash cost of maintenance exceeds the asset's terminal market value; rapid working capital depletion leads to distressed herd liquidation and farm-level insolvency.

Illustrative Example

How This Risk Can Manifest

In Animal Protein / Poultry (ISIC 0146):

A 2026 drought causes soy prices to surge 80%; because birds are already in the growth cycle (LI02), producers must buy feed at a loss, resulting in a cost-per-kg that exceeds retail market prices.

Action Plan

What To Do

Immediate steps to address or mitigate this scenario:

  1. Utilize 'Basis Hedging' for 12-month forward coverage
  2. invest in Feed-Conversion Ratio (FCR) genetics
  3. implement insect or algae-based alternative protein blending to reduce grain dependency.
